How much do entry level google full stack developer jobs pay per hour?

As of May 30, 2026, the average hourly pay for entry level google full stack developer in the United States is $59.26,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$49.28 and $68.27 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

Full Stack Developer
The Opportunity :
Everyone is trying to harness the power of cloud and emerging technologies-but not everyone knows how to apply them effectively. As a Full Stack Developer, you'll support the development of applications and services for a Digital Twin and Modeling & Simulation platform operating in hybrid and regulated environments.
You'll contribute to building prototype solutions using a modern technology stack and help evolve them into production-ready systems that support real-world mission needs. This role offers the opportunity to gain experience developing interactive and data-driven applications, including those used for visualization, simulation, and analysis.
You'll work closely with platform engineers, DevSecOps teams, and senior developers to build scalable, secure, and reliable solutions across cloud, on-premises, and constrained environments. You'll help analyze user needs and system requirements to ensure solutions align with existing architecture and support future mission capabilities.
In this role, you'll continuously learn new tools and technologies, contribute to system improvements, and support the delivery of resilient, high-impact solutions. Join our team as we build and scale Digital Twin capabilities to solve complex, real-world challenges.
Join us. The world can't wait.
You Have:
  • 1+ years of experience in full-stack development using modern frameworks such as React or Angular
  • Experience building modular, scalable applications using microservices-based architectures
  • Experience with JavaScript and front-end frameworks
  • Experience working in Agile or Scrum environments
  • Knowledge of object-oriented programming with tools such as C# or Java
  • Knowledge of back-end development using Python, SQL, and RESTful APIs
  • Knowledge of sof t war e design patterns and building applications for both cloud and on-prem environments
  • Knowledge of AWS, Azure, or Google Cloud Platform, including basic deployment and service usage
  • Ability to obtain a Secret clearance
  • Bachelor's degree in Computer Science or Engineering

Booz Allen Hamilton is a leading provider of management and technology consulting services to the US government in defense, intelligence, and civil markets. Headquartered in McLean, Virginia, the firm also serves major corporations, institutions, and not-for-profit organizations. Founded in 1914 by Edwin G. Booz, the company has a long-standing tradition of helping clients achieve success by delivering a wide range of consulting services that include strategic planning, human capital and learning, communication, systems development, and others. The company's mission is to empower people to change the world, and it has a reputation for maintaining the highest standards of integrity and-excellence.
